
Barbara Drapcho
Barbara Drapcho is a clarinet instructor at Carthage College. She has studied with Russell Dagon, Charlene Zimmerman, Alan Kay, and Dennis Nygre, and is a member of Quintet Attacca.
As a member of Quintet Attacca, she has performed on New York City’s Schneider Concert Series, Chamber Music Society of Detroit, and numerous Chicagoland series such as NEIU’s Jewel Box, Chicago Philharmonic’s Chamber Players, Rush Hour, Dame Myra Hess, and live broadcasts on WFMT. Her chamber music experience outside of Quintet Attacca includes performances with the Chicago Chamber Musicians, international Chamber Artists, and Milwaukee’s Present Music.
Ms. Drapcho is a grand-prize winner of the Fischoff Chamber Music Competition and is an ensemble-in-residence at the Music Institute of Chicago.
She is acting principal clarinet of the Rockford Symphony Orchestra and also a member of New Philharmonic. She has performed as a soloist with Chicago Arts Orchestra and is a former member of the Civic Orchestra of Chicago.
Ms. Drapcho has performed with the Chicago Symphony Orchestra, Chicago Opera Theater, and Northwest Indiana, South Bend, Lake Forest, and Elgin Symphony Orchestras.
Ms. Drapcho is on faculty at the Music Institute of Chicago, North Park University, and UW-Parkside.
- Bachelor’s — Northwestern University
- Master’s — Northwestern University
